United Airlines says it will buy up to 200 small electric air taxis to help customers in urban areas get to airports
11 February 2021
The airline will help electric-aircraft startup Archer develop an aircraft capable of helicopter-style, vertical takeoffs and landings.
Archer hopes to deliver its first aircraft in 2024, if it wins certification from the Federal Aviation Administration.
United says once the aircraft are flying, it and partner Mesa Airlines will acquire up to 200 to be operated by another company.
